Kelley Birney is the co-founder of the Southern Fried Film Festival, currently in its sixth year running in Huntsville. Kelley spent 27 years of her career as a professional actor in movies, tv, and commercials and has now joined forces with long-time friend and producer Trevite Willis to bring a film festival to North Alabama.
Kelley shares insights into how they select films, the inclusion of music and technology in the festival, attracting sponsors, and providing fans an incredible experience.
